The Bailey Toastmasters Club is hosting a baseball-themed open house on Thursday, June 9, from 7:00 to 8:30 p.m. at the Euclid Public Library.  The open house provides the community the opportunity to see a Toastmasters meeting conducted. The meeting is free and open to the public. Food and refreshments will be served.

Toastmasters International is a world leader in communication and leadership development. Our membership is 292,000 strong. These members improve their speaking and leadership skills by attending one of the 14,350 clubs in 122 countries that make up our global network of meeting locations.
